About the Role

The Residential Property Solicitor role based in Worcestershire requires a qualified lawyer or legal executive with two or more years’ PQE. This full-time position within a leading regional firm offers a salary between £40,000 and £55,000, dependent on experience. The successful candidate will manage the entire conveyancing process, handling sales, purchases, re-mortgages, transfers of equity, and new development work. Managing your own caseload independently is essential, as is delivering thorough client service. This role is ideal for those already living in Worcestershire or Shropshire, or those wishing to return to the region.
